Quality railway sleepers undergo pressure treatment ensuring decades of ground contact without rot. Installation depth varies - shallow beds require 600mm foundations whilst retaining walls demand concrete footings below frost line. Proper drainage channels prevent water pooling behind structures. Each sleeper gets coach-bolted through pre-drilled holes, creating rigid frameworks that won't shift during Bromley's wet winters.

Clay actually provides excellent stability once properly prepared. We incorporate gravel bases and perforated pipes ensuring water drains away rather than saturating the timber. Many BR2 gardens successfully use sleepers despite challenging ground conditions.
